Warning Signs You Need School Water Damage Restoration

Catching water damage early is key to minimizing its impact and cost. Ignoring small signs can lead to significantly larger issues later. Be aware of these common indicators that suggest you need professional help for your school property.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

A persistent damp or musty smell, especially in classrooms or common areas, is a strong indicator of hidden moisture. This often means mold is starting to grow behind walls or under flooring, requiring immediate professional attention to remove the source.

Visible Water Stains or Discoloration

Stains on ceilings, walls, or floors are obvious signs that water has been present. Even if the water has receded, the staining indicates that the material has been saturated and may be compromised, needing thorough drying and repair.

Peeling or Bubbling Paint and Wallpaper

When moisture gets behind paint or wallpaper, it causes the adhesive to fail, leading to peeling or bubbling. This is a clear sign of water intrusion and suggests that the underlying wall material may also be damp, requiring expert assessment and drying.

Warped or Damaged Flooring

Water can cause hard flooring materials like laminate or wood to warp, buckle, or delaminate. Carpet can become waterlogged and develop mold. Addressing this early can prevent the need for a complete floor replacement, saving you significant restoration costs.

Sagging Ceilings or Walls

Structural components can be weakened by prolonged exposure to water. A sagging ceiling or wall is a serious warning sign that indicates significant water saturation and potential structural damage, demanding an urgent professional inspection.

Increased Humidity Levels

If the air inside your school feels unusually damp or humid, it could be due to an undetected water leak or inadequate drying after a previous incident. High humidity can foster mold growth and damage sensitive electronics, so it needs prompt investigation.

School Water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Minor spill on a tile floor (less than 1 sq ft) Yes No Easy to clean up and dry yourself.
Leaking faucet causing a small puddle under the sink Yes No Can usually be managed with towels and fans.
Water stains on a single ceiling tile from a minor roof leak Maybe Yes Could indicate a larger roof issue; professional assessment is wise.
Burst pipe flooding a classroom or hallway No Yes Requires specialized equipment for rapid, thorough drying and potential structural assessment.
Water damage originating from a sewage backup (Category 2 or 3 water) Absolutely Not Yes Extreme health hazard requiring containment and specialized remediation.
Water damage impacting electrical systems or structural integrity No Yes Safety risk; requires expert knowledge to assess and repair safely.

For anything beyond a very minor spill, especially in a school environment, calling a professional is the smart choice. The risks associated with improper drying and potential mold growth are too high to attempt a DIY fix for significant water damage. Professionals have the tools and training to handle complex water intrusion scenarios effectively.

What are the health risks associated with water damage in schools?

The primary health risk is mold growth, which can start within 24-48 hours in damp conditions. Mold spores can trigger allergies, asthma attacks, and other respiratory problems. Standing water can also create slip hazards and, if it’s contaminated water, can spread bacteria. Will my insurance cover the cost of school water damage restoration?

In most cases, water damage caused by sudden and accidental events like burst pipes or storms is covered by insurance. However, damage from slow leaks or lack of maintenance might not be.
